The neurogenic type is the most common and presents with pain, weakness, paraesthesia, and occasionally loss of muscle at the base of the thumb. [1] [2] The venous type results in swelling, pain, and possibly a bluish coloration of the arm. [2] The arterial type results in pain, coldness, and pallor of the arm. [2]
Middle back pain, also known as thoracic back pain, is back pain that is felt in the region of the thoracic vertebrae, which are between the bottom of the neck and top of the lumbar spine. It has a number of potential causes, ranging from muscle strain to collapse of a vertebra or rare serious diseases.

Postoperative radiation is delivered within 2–3 weeks of surgical decompression. Emergency radiation therapy (usually 20 grays in 5 fractions, 30 grays in 10 fractions or 8 grays in 1 fraction) is the mainstay of treatment for malignant spinal cord compression. It is very effective as pain control and local disease control.
The most common mechanism leading to thoracic aortic injury is a motor vehicle collision. Other mechanisms include airplane crashes, falling from a large height and landing on a hard surface, or any injury that causes substantial pressure to the sternum. [10] The incidence of thoracic aortic injuries is approximately 1 in 100,000. [6]
Spinal stenosis is an abnormal narrowing of the spinal canal or neural foramen that results in pressure on the spinal cord or nerve roots. [6] Symptoms may include pain, numbness , or weakness in the arms or legs. [ 1 ]
